bizaloo.net is a free url submission site where you can choose some unique categories for your site. bizaloo.net is a free url submission site where you can choose some unique categories for your site. Submit your site to increase traffic and improve google pagerank.
Customer Reviews for Bizaloo
Be the first to review Bizaloo - Use the thumbs to get started!